Brown honored for adoption work

    “Outstanding, Adoption Caseworker of the Year 2007 Janice Brown: Adoptive & Foster Families of Maine.” Those are the words inscribed on a plaque received by Janice from the State of Maine recently.

Image     Brown is a licensed social worker employed by the State of Maine. Her mother, energetic and well-known Molly Bailey, was present when she received this honor.
     Molly quotes Janice as saying, “The children brighten up when she tells them that she herself was adopted.”
   Brown first worked in Camden. but Rockland has been her home for 13 years now. She has two Labrador dogs, but to go back to her roots, she is a graduate of Houlton High School, class of 1975. From Ricker in 1978, she received an Associate Degree; then in 1980, she received a Bachelor of Arts in physiology from Salem College in West Virginia.
   Her hobbies next to her dogs is that she enjoys walking. She is very proud of her recent honor.
